Cantata I: Ad pedes (To the Feet): Ecce super montes - Chorus is a song by The Sixteen, released on 2010-04-01. It is track number 6 in the album Membra Jesu Nostri. Cantata I: Ad pedes (To the Feet): Ecce super montes - Chorus has a BPM/tempo of 77 beats per minute, is in the key of B min and has a duration of 1 minute, 24 seconds.
